Pros

I got to interpret in Ministry of Justice context

Cons

The MoJ paid millions for the interpreting services contract. The money was pocketed by MoJ. Their app looked and worked as if created by a teenager who has just learned coding, the invoicing was subpar and the staff were overworked and rude. Interpreters were paid ridiculously low fees, no travel time, abysmal travel costs. If you booked a 3 hour assignment and the defendant was no show or the case was dismissed or dealt with in 5 mins you would only get paid for one hour. You could end up travelling for one hour or more to go to a court, then back, and make £25. After deducting the travel you were out of pocket. This experience caused me to completely give up the profession after studying and passing exams to get the diploma in level 6 interpreting. Many interpreters did the same. When I left the profession most interpreters in courts were unqualified because no good interpreter was interested in being exploited by TBW.
